    Abstract: A microtool for manipulating components is proposed. A component is held with the microtool by at least one gripper arm having a gripping surface, the gripper being movable by an actuator structure. Also provided is a device for releasing the held component from the gripping surface, whereby an acceleration is induced in the gripper arm for at least a time, and the force of inertia resulting from the inertial mass of the held component and the exerted acceleration will be greater than any force of adhesion acting between the held component and the gripping surface. A process is also proposed for producing a microtool or a microtool part, in particular a microgripper by micropatterning.

    Abstract: Coatings of dialkylsilyloxy groups are applied to water-wettable surfaces by chemical vapor deposition using dihalodialkylsilanes with short-chain alkyl groups. Some of the surfaces which will benefit from the application of these coatings are hydroxyl-terminated silicon surfaces of microelectromechanical systems, nanoelectromechanical systems, and biomicroelectromechanical systems, while surfaces of other chemistries will benefit as well. When applied to a microstructure on an MEMS surface, the coating reduces stiction in the microstructure. The use of the vapor phase as a deposition medium facilitates the deposition process and permits close control over the reaction conditions and the characteristics of the resulting coating.

    Abstract: A method for epitaxial deposition of atoms or molecules from a reactive gas on a deposition surface of a substrate is described. The method includes the following steps: a first amount of energy is supplied by heating at least the deposition surface; and an ionized inert gas is conducted, at least from time to time, onto the deposition surface in order to supply, at least from time to time, a second amount of energy through the effect of ions of the ionized inert gas on the deposition surface. The first amount of energy is less than the energy amount necessary for the epitaxial deposition of atoms or molecules of the reactive gas on the deposition surface. A sum of the first energy amount and the second energy equaling, at least from time to time, a total amount of energy that is sufficient for the epitaxial deposition of atoms or molecules of the reactive gas onto the deposition surface.

    Abstract: A method for producing a thin film on a carrier substrate. For this purpose, a buried sacrificial layer is initially produced in the interior of a parent body, the buried sacrificial layer separating a layer from a residual body remaining from the parent body. After that, the carrier substrate is attached to the layer and the sacrificial layer is then removed. As a result, the thin film to be produced comes into being on the carrier substrate. The method is suitable for the production of electronic components or thin-film solar cells, the parent body being made up, for example, of monocrystalline silicon in which a sacrificial layer of porous silicon is produced.

    Abstract: A gyroscope system including multiple rotating or oscillating disks filters out disturbance acceleration inputs such as vibrations or jarring while detecting and measuring external angular velocity. The gyroscope disks are decoupled from a substrate to decrease the impact of external vibrations on the gyroscope operation. The gyroscope disks are rotated in opposite directions or oscillated out of phase to decrease the impact of disturbance vibrations and jarring while more accurately measuring external angular velocities applied to the system.

    Abstract: A method for removing layers or layer systems from a substrate and subsequent application onto an alternative substrate. A porous breakaway layer is formed by anodization in hydrofluoric acid. Optionally, a stabilizing layer with lower porosity is previously produced on top of the breakaway layer. The oxide of the porous breakaway layer or the stabilizing layer is removed by brief contact with HF, and an epitaxial layer is applied on the porous breakaway layer or the stabilizing layer. The epitaxial layer or the layer system is then removed from the substrate, and the epitaxial layer or the layer system is applied onto an alternative substrate. Optionally, the stabilizing layer and/or residues of the breakaway layer are removed from the epitaxial layer.

    Abstract: A method of producing an optical waveguide, in which a substrate of silicon is etched porously to a defined depth by anodic oxidation in an electrolyte containing hydrofluoric acid. The etched substrate is doped in a suitable dopant liquid containing cations. The doped layer of porous silicon is stabilized at an elevated temperature, and the stabilized layer is oxidized with a further increase in temperature. The oxidized porous layer is made to collapse at a temperature sufficient for partial melting. The surface of the collapsed silicon dioxide layer is covered in a pattern by a lithographic technique, and the cations are replaced by silver ions in the uncovered areas of the surface by bringing the surface in contact with a solution containing silver ions or silver complex ions.
